Description Suggest change

This crag faces due East so morning sun is guarantied. The rock is sharp but bomber so bring some thick calluses. If you encounter a climbing party here I would be surprised.

I highly recommend super glue with a brush to apply to the tips. Re-apply after each burn and you can make the day last a bit longer.

Getting There Suggest change

Take highway 6 out of Delta going south; from the LAST house in Hinkley go 6 miles to a dirt road on your right. Follow the dirt road for 41 miles taking the signs that point to Marjum Pass, at the major bend in the road, park and look to the west, this is the Buffalo Bill Wall. Approach the wall by walking up to the ?DogPound?, the DogPound is the wall with the big under cut cave and the beautiful blue streaks and pockets. There should be a cairn system leading you north/west towards the Buffalo Bill Wall
